Spec Brawl: Mazda MX-5 vs. Honda Civic Type R

DMS Fasteners |

In the world of Japanese Domestic Market (JDM) sports cars, the Mazda MX-5 Miata and Honda Civic Type R stand out as iconic contenders. Let's compare their specifications to see which one dominates the segment:

1. Engine Performance:

  • Mazda MX-5 Miata: Powered by a 2.0-liter naturally aspirated inline-4 engine, the MX-5 Miata produces 181 horsepower and 151 lb-ft of torque. While not the most powerful in its class, the Miata's lightweight chassis and responsive handling make it a joy to drive, offering a pure and engaging driving experience.

  • Honda Civic Type R: Equipped with a turbocharged 2.0-liter inline-4 engine, the Civic Type R delivers impressive power with 306 horsepower and 295 lb-ft of torque. Its high-performance engine, coupled with a precise six-speed manual transmission and adaptive suspension, enables exhilarating acceleration and precise handling on both road and track.

Winner: Honda Civic Type R, for its higher horsepower and torque output, and exhilarating performance.

2. Handling and Dynamics:

  • Mazda MX-5 Miata: Renowned for its exceptional handling and balanced chassis, the MX-5 Miata features near-perfect weight distribution, precise steering, and a low center of gravity. Its rear-wheel-drive layout and responsive suspension provide nimble and agile handling, allowing drivers to carve through corners with confidence and control.

  • Honda Civic Type R: Known for its track-focused dynamics and exceptional grip, the Civic Type R features a front-wheel-drive layout with a limited-slip differential, adaptive dampers, and a lightweight chassis. Its advanced chassis tuning and aerodynamic design provide stability at high speeds and sharp cornering abilities, making it a formidable contender on the track.

Winner: Tie. Both vehicles offer exceptional handling and dynamics, tailored to deliver an engaging and thrilling driving experience.

3. Interior Comfort and Features:

  • Mazda MX-5 Miata: Features a driver-focused interior with a minimalist design and intuitive controls. The Miata's cabin offers supportive sport seats, available leather upholstery, and modern amenities such as a touchscreen infotainment system with smartphone integration and available Bose audio system. While compact, the Miata's interior provides a comfortable and immersive driving environment.

  • Honda Civic Type R: Boasts a more spacious and practical interior compared to the MX-5 Miata, with comfortable seating for up to five passengers and a range of premium features. The Type R's cabin features sporty accents, supportive bucket seats, a leather-wrapped steering wheel, and an intuitive infotainment system with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ility.

Winner: Honda Civic Type R, for its more spacious interior and advanced technology features.

4. Price and Value:

  • Mazda MX-5 Miata: Positioned as an affordable and accessible sports car, the MX-5 Miata offers excellent value for its performance capabilities and driving experience. With a lower starting price and lower cost of ownership compared to the Civic Type R, the Miata appeals to enthusiasts seeking a fun and affordable sports car.

  • Honda Civic Type R: Positioned as a high-performance hot hatch, the Civic Type R commands a higher price tag due to its turbocharged engine, track-focused capabilities, and advanced technology features. While it offers unmatched performance and versatility, the Type R's higher cost of ownership may deter some buyers.

Winner: Mazda MX-5 Miata, for its more affordable price and accessible performance.

Conclusion:

In the battle between the Mazda MX-5 Miata and Honda Civic Type R, both JDM sports cars offer impressive capabilities and exhilarating driving experiences. The Civic Type R dominates with its higher horsepower, track-focused handling, and advanced technology features, making it a top choice for driving enthusiasts seeking uncompromising performance and versatility. However, the MX-5 Miata holds its own with its exceptional handling, balanced chassis, and affordable price, appealing to enthusiasts looking for a pure and engaging driving experience. Ultimately, the choice between these two iconic JDM cars comes down to individual preferences, whether it's raw performance, handling dynamics, or value for money.
